Approximate heights – please note proposed towers may vary:

Highest Proposed but not permitted:
Dalmarnock Tower – 180 metres high

Highest Permitted but not built:
Elphinstone Place – 134 metres high

Highest existing:
Glasgow tower – 125 metres high
